Course Reserves FAQs

What are course reserves?

Course reserves comprise many of the required and optional readings for the current semester's classes—often from the books and other resources that students are not required to buy. In order to ensure that every student in a class has access to the necessary materials, items on course reserve only check out for short periods of time -- a couple hours, overnight, or perhaps a few days. The professors determine what is placed on reserve and how long the check-out period should be (taking into account the size of the class and the length of the reading).

How do I find out what's on reserve?

Items that are on reserve are marked as such in the Library catalog. The catalog also contains a list of items on reserve for each class. You can search for reserve lists by class name or number, or by the name of your instructor.

Where do I go to get course reserves?

The course reserves are shelved behind the circulation desk at the entrance to the Library. A Library staff member will be glad to help you get the materials that you need.

What's the difference between “reserves” and “reference”?

The course reserves are a temporary collection of high-demand items that are being used for particular classes. Items on reserve can only be checked out for short periods of time.

The reference section (on the main floor of the Library) is a permanent collection of items designated for use on site only -- either because we always want a copy of the item available, or because the nature of the item is that it is used for quick referral instead of extended reading. Items in reference cannot be checked out.

Reserve Loan Periods and Fines

Make sure you bring your student ID when coming to the Library to use reserve materials. Even if you don't plan on leaving the Library, items on reserve cannot leave the circulation desk without being checked out.

Reserve Type Due Date Renewals Fines
1 Hour 1 hour Once (1 hour) 50¢ per hour
2 Hour 2 hours Once (1 hour) 50¢ per hour
3 Hour 3 hours Twice (1 hour each) 50¢ per hour
Overnight 1 hour after the Library opens the next day None 50¢ per hour
2 Day Any time before closing 2 days later None $2 per day
3 Day Any time before closing 3 days later None $2 per day
1 Week Any time before closing 1 week later None $2 per day
Limits

Please note that you may only check out up to 2 hourly reserve items and 2 overnight/multi-day reserve items at a time.
